Protein Name: Dihydrolipoyllysine-residue acetyltransferase component of pyruvate dehydrogenase complex, mitochondrial

UniprotKB/SwissProt ID: Q8BMF4 (Q8BMF4)

Gene Name: Dlat

Organism: Mus musculus (Mouse)

Function: As part of the pyruvate dehydrogenase complex, catalyzes the transfers of an acetyl group to a lipoic acid moiety. The pyruvate dehydrogenase complex, catalyzes the overall conversion of pyruvate to acetyl-CoA and CO(2), and thereby links cytoplasmic glycolysis and the mitochondrial tricarboxylic acid (TCA) cycle

Other Modifications: View all modification sites in dbPTM

Protein Subcellular Localization: Mitochondrion matrix
